Service Electrical Engineer
Role Overview:
As a Service Electrical Engineer , you'll support the installation, commissioning, modification, and maintenance of Low Voltage (415V) and Medium Voltage (11kV) switchgear and related equipment.
Key Responsibilities:
Installation: Offloading, aligning, wiring, bolting, testing (Flash, Megger, Ducter), and retrofitting switchgear.Pre-commissioning: Check control wiring, mechanical/electrical interlocks, and breaker functionality; input protection relay settings.Commissioning (SAT): Conduct full function tests, verify relay settings, and provide detailed site reports.Documentation: Complete reports, test certificates, timesheets, and expenses accurately and promptly.Communication: Maintain clear and professional verbal and written communication with clients and internal teams.Skills & Experience Required:
Strong background in electrical switchgear systems (especially in Oil & Gas/Petrochem industries). Skilled in testing electronic protection relays and reading schematic diagrams. Experience working on-site in the UK and internationally. ONC in Electrical Engineering or equivalent.Full UK driving licence and legal right to work in the UK.Must be eligible for SC Clearance Personal Qualities:
